A certified board resolution is a written document that provides an explanation of the actions of a company's board of directors that has been verified by the secretary of the organization and approved by the board's president.

The SBA imposes strict record-keeping requirements on EIDL borrowers. They must keep itemized receipts showing how they spend the loan funds. A full set of financial statements are required to be furnished to the SBA each year.
SBA Form 160, Resolution of Board of Directors is a form issued by the Small Business Administration (SBA) and filed with SBA Business Expansion loans - including Direct, Guaranteed, or Participation loans.

The EIDL documents require a Board Resolution to be submitted within 6 months of loan disbursement. Proof of Hazard insurance is due within 1 year of loan disbursement.
EIDL Loan Forgiveness. EIDL loans cannot be forgiven. EIDL loans do have a deferment period, however. Loans made during the 2020 calendar year have a 24-month deferment window from the date of the note.
